TransAmsterdamTransartSchool

TransAmsterdam, a trans organization for art, culture and lifestyle and organizes the Trans Art School. Our Trans Art School consists of creative workshops for and by trans people. See 'Activities' or follow us on social media to stay informed about upcoming workshops and to register. 

​With art and culture we connect trans people with each other and with people outside the trans community. This also shows that trans people are more than their gender. ​With our workshops we create connection within our community in a safe and positive way.

Who can participate in the Trans Art School?

 

Trans and non-binary persons are welcome to enroll at the Trans Art School. This way you can develop your talents with the workshops and meet like-minded people in an accessible way. For questions please contact us at tas@transamsterdam.nl

In 2019 we launched the Trans Art School - Open Day with great enthusiasm. From 2019 to 2022, we successfully organized the trans newcomers art project and trans youth art project. In October, November and December 2022 we will organize new workshops for trans and non-binary people.

In the workshops we take into account the participants' background and gender identity.

What is the program?


We are going to organize various workshops. Some examples are;spoken word, theatre, drag, painting, sing-songwriting and dance. After the workshops there is a final presentation and performances during various events. More information later.

Our Trans Art School has many enthusiastic teachers, and an even greater diversity of art forms and creative sessions.

How much does it cost to join?

Fortunately, thanks to funding, Trans Amsterdam can offer these workshops in an accessible way. The costs for participation are5 Europer person per workshop day.Contact usif you are unable to participate due to your financial situation.

Security and Anonymity


Because the Meevaart is a public building, this gives many a feeling of safety, because no one knows for which organization you are visiting.
 

During the workshops, our activities will take place behind closed doors in a space reserved only for us. We hope to create a pleasant creative atmosphere where everyone can feel at ease.

 

Respect for your privacy is our top priority: during workshops you decide whether and how you take the stage, which we offer you. If photography or filming takes place during a workshop, this will ALWAYS be clearly indicated in advance. Moreover, the same workshop will also be repeated without the presence of cameras.
